A 37-year-old man has been charged with first-degree murder in connection with the fatal shooting of 32-year-old India Johnson in Baltimore County.

BALTIMORE, Md. — Baltimore County Police have arrested a suspect in the homicide of a woman who was fatally shot earlier this month on Treeway Court.

Investigators identified the suspect as Michael Burnett, 37, who was taken into custody Monday in connection with the death of India Johnson, 32.

According to police, the shooting occurred at approximately 11:55 a.m. on Sunday, Aug. 2, in the unit block of Treeway Court in Baltimore County.

Detectives charge suspect with first-degree murder

Following an investigation by homicide detectives, Burnett was arrested and charged with multiple offenses, including first-degree murder.

“Homicide detectives arrested 37-year-old Michael Burnett earlier today in connection with the fatal shooting of 32-year-old India Johnson,” the Baltimore County Police Department said in announcing the arrest.

Burnett is currently being held without bond at the Baltimore County Detention Center, according to police.

Investigators have not released additional details regarding the circumstances of the shooting or a possible motive.

The investigation remains ongoing, and detectives have not indicated whether additional arrests are expected.
